Introduction
Android phones, particularly the developer-friendly Nexus models from Google, are especially suited for unlocking and tinkering with. The OS, based upon Linux, is modular enough to allow replacement and upgrading of particular components of the firmware: bootloader, recovery, boot, radio, etc.
How often these are udpated, and how accessible to the user, will vary from one manufacturer to another, and from one model to another.
== Warning ==
Unlocking, flashing, rooting your phone may void the warranty. You are also at risk for "bricking" (rendering inoperable and unrepairable) your phone. You assume full liability and responsibility for attempting to follow any of these steps.
